Four Seasons of Color, One Plant
Jelly Bean® puts on a visual show from spring through winter. Light green foliage with attractive red-tipped new growth through the growing season transitions to a brilliant display of yellow and red fall color — rivaling ornamental shrubs that produce no fruit at all. In late July through early August, the bush fills with medium-to-large, sweet, juicy blueberries that make the whole season worthwhile.
Made for Containers and Small Spaces
At just 12–24 inches tall and wide at maturity, Jelly Bean® is one of the most container-friendly blueberry varieties available. It thrives in pots, planters, and patio gardens, making it an excellent choice for growers without the space for a traditional blueberry patch. Its compact size also makes it easy to manage soil pH — critical for blueberry success — right in the container.

Characteristics
| Bloom Color | White |
| Bloom Time | Mid |
| Chill Hours | 1000 - 1200 |
| Fruit Color | Blue |
| Fruit Size | Medium - Large |
| Hardiness Zone Range | 4 - 8 |
| Pollination | Self-Pollinating |
| Ripens/Harvest | Late July To Early August |
| Shade/Sun | Full Sun |
| Soil Composition | Sandy |
| Soil Moisture | Well Drained |
| Soil pH Level | 4.5 - 5.5 |
| Taste | Sweet |
| Texture | Firm, Juicy |
| Years to Bear | 1 - 2 |
